Police called to Ashford's Eureka Skyway bridge over fears for young man

By: Danny Boyle

Published: 14:42, 19 November 2012

Police were called to the Eureka Skyway footbridge over the M20 at Ashford, following fears for the safety of a young man said to be on the wrong side of the railings.

The incident happened at about midday on Monday following a report of concern for a person on the bridge, which opened last year between the Sainsbury's Bybook store and the Eureka leisure park.

Officers attended and the young man was taken to the William Harvey hospital.
